linkding is a self-hosted bookmark manager designed for saving, organizing, and retrieving web links. It functions as a centralized, private repository for personal link collections, featuring multi-user support and authentication to manage access and shared bookmarks.

Shiori is a self-hosted bookmark manager and webpage archiving tool. Written in Go, it functions as a backend service that allows users to save, organize, and search for web links while maintaining a private collection of online resources. The system ensures content availability by creating offline copies of saved pages, preventing data loss if the original source is removed. It is distributed as a containerized application to provide consistent installation and deployment across different operating systems. Buku is a personal bookmark manager that provides a command line interface, a portable bookmark database, and a self-hosted server for organizing web links. It functions as a command line knowledge base for saving, tagging, and searching web resources. The system features a portable, mergeable database that supports AES-256 encryption and is designed for cross-device data synchronization. It includes a RESTful API and a self-hosted web interface, allowing users to manage their collection via a browser or programmatic requests. Shaarli is a self-hosted bookmark manager and knowledge base designed for organizing web links and notes in a private, searchable library. It functions as a flat-file content platform, storing information in structured text files rather than requiring an external database management system. The system emphasizes data portability and content distribution, providing tools for archiving bookmarks in portable formats and generating RSS and Atom feeds for digital content syndication. Linkwarden is a self-hosted bookmark manager and web archiving platform designed to preserve permanent copies of online content. It functions as a centralized repository where users can capture, store, and organize web pages to ensure they remain accessible even if the original source is removed. The platform distinguishes itself through its focus on collaborative knowledge management and multi-platform capture.
